H.R. 2672 (106th)

To authorize the President to award a gold medal on behalf of the Congress to General Henry H. Shelton and to provide for the production of bronze duplicates of such medal for sale to the public.

Summary

Authorizes the President, on behalf of the Congress, to present a congressional gold medal to General Henry H. Shelton in recognition of his exemplary performance as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ff in coordinating the planning, strategy, and execution of the United States and NATO combat action and his invaluable contributions to the United States and to the successful return to peace in the Balkans. Authorizes the Secretary of the Treasury to strike and sell bronze duplicates. Authorizes appropriations.
